
Hemis National Park facts for kids
Hemis National Park (or Hemis High Altitude National Park) is a high altitude National Park in the Eastern Ladakh area of the state of Jammu and Kashmir in India. It is the only national park in India north of the Himalayas.
The park is home to about 200 snow leopards. Hemis is the only refuge in India with the Shapu. The Tibetan Wolf,the Eurasian Brown Bear, and the Red Fox are also in Hemis.
